Understanding Risk in Both Worlds

A key task for computer engineers is to assess digital risks before building a system. Their goal is to protect users from security breaches, data loss, and misuse. This means anticipating threats and designing defenses from the ground up. Similarly, a fence company in Chicago will begin every project by evaluating what each customer needs protection from. Is it keeping intruders out, ensuring pets stay in, or clearly marking property lines? The right fencing solution depends on understanding these vulnerabilities.

Both computer engineers and fencers invest time up front to weigh potential risks. They recommend solutions that balance cost, effectiveness, and long-term reliability. Just as weak encryption can create entry points for hackers, a poorly installed fence can leave a property exposed. Both professions must manage the real consequences of a breach.
